m-joy 15 Posted November 16, 2016 Share Posted November 16, 2016 Okay SPMC, kodi and mx player work with audio passtru, also hd audio. The problem with mx player is that the refresh rate switch does not work. Using spmc or kodi is a litttle bit weird to me... The build in emby player sux, passthrough no more working for me, hd audio neither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Heuer 76 Posted November 17, 2016 Share Posted November 17, 2016 Try Archos player.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
m-joy 15 Posted November 17, 2016 Share Posted November 17, 2016 Hi thank you. Archos player using passthrough methode 2 and enabling refresh rate switch is the only solution so far for me to have hd audio passtrough and refresh rate switching working with emby... ebr 14944 Posted November 18, 2016 Share Posted November 18, 2016 I remember that passtrhough was working some time ago. Bitstreaming of the standard audio codecs still does work (AC3, DTS). HD Audio has never been supported in this app (yet).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
